Hello
I know Sydney Carter wrote the song and am fairly sure he wrote it as a protest song at the time of the Cuban Misile Crisi. Can anyone confirm this?

The song was in Sing Out, Vol 11, #5
Dec-Jan 1961-2.

Indeed Carter wrote it (although I read it may have been based on an earlier song). I doubt it was written as a protest about the Cuban Missile Crisis specifically, because he would have to have written it earlier than the crisis in order to meet Sing Out`s publishing deadlines, etc.

Perhaps I should explain more clearly. No doubt the song was influenced by the history of the time, but the Cuban Missile Crisis was October, 1962, and the song pre-dates that.
